10. Pro Payments
Pro purchases may be processed through a third party cryptocurrency payment service.
The payment process may involve a payment address, payment amount, payment reference, transaction identifier, and payment status.
Cryptocurrency transactions may be irreversible once broadcast or confirmed on the applicable blockchain network. Users are responsible for carefully checking payment details before sending funds.
FilePriv cannot reverse a blockchain transaction that has already been sent to an incorrect address or otherwise completed on the relevant network.

13. Metadata and Privacy Tools
FilePriv may provide tools designed to remove metadata or otherwise process information contained within supported files.
Such tools should be considered practical processing utilities rather than guarantees of complete anonymity.
Removing metadata from a file does not necessarily remove every possible identifying characteristic from its contents. Users remain responsible for reviewing the resulting file where privacy is particularly important.

15. Processing Results
File conversion and processing tools depend on underlying software, file structures, formats, and other technical factors.
FilePriv does not guarantee that every uploaded file will process successfully or that a generated result will be identical to the original file in every respect.
Some formatting, embedded content, fonts, metadata, interactive elements, or other characteristics may change during conversion.
You should inspect important converted files before relying on them for business, legal, financial, archival, or other critical purposes.
